Bamburgh School has no sixth form. Of the 27 pupils who finished Year 11 there in 2023, none moved to a sixth form college, 44% to a further education college and none started an apprenticeship.
Almost nobody goes straight into an apprenticeship or a job: none took an apprenticeship and none went into work, against 3% and 3% across England.
Bamburgh School is a special school: its GCSE figures (Attainment 8 of 9.8, 4% with grade 5 or above in English and maths) are published by DfE for completeness and are not comparable with mainstream schools.
Destinations of the 2023 Year 11 leavers, measured the following year: the share in a sustained place for at least two terms. Compared with all state-funded schools in South Tyneside and England.
